Anita Harris Cobridge High Fired Ruskin Glazed Art Pottery Vase

About the Item

An exceptional, impressive unique Cobridge pottery ruskin glazed vase by Anita Harris and glazed by Justin Emery and dating from around 2000. The large round bulbous stoneware vase stands on a round skirted base with a widening round body and short flared top rim. The body of the vase is decorated in high fired deep red glazes with green almost textured like markings and with a deep blue interior. The vase bears various impressed makers marks to the base and comes with an original Certificate of Authenticity recording this as a Trial Piece by Anita Harris and bearing her signature. The vase further has a red paper label from the Henry Sandon Collection sale at Mallams, Oxford on 23rd May 2012. It also has hand-written detail (probably by Sandon himself) reading ‘JUSTIN EMERY Cobridge stoneware – now deceased – he was able to produce the high temperature wares of Ruskin – a great secret which he said would die with him’. Provenance: from the collection of a private gentleman and originating from the UK art market. From the Henry Sandon Collection and sold by Mallams, Oxford on 23rd May 2012. In good condition.
